---The Windsor Star (Windsor, Ontario, Canada) 12 April 1954

Caven, Hazel (23 January 1892-12 April 1954)


Native of Greenwood, Wisconsin, Mrs. Hazel Malissa Caven, wife of Roy
Caven, 863 Marentette Avenue, died in Grace Hospital on Saturday, at age
62.

Mrs. Caven, a member of the United Church, has lived in Windsor for
the past 33 years, before which she resided in Picton.

Surviving, in addition to her husband, are a son Ira Irwin Werden
Caven, of Keswick, Ontario, a daughter, Mrs. Dorothy Zinck, of Windsor,
six grandchildren; two great-grandchildren; and a sister, Mrs. Nettie
Cox, of Wisconsin.

Funeral services will be be conducted by the Rev. Gordon W. Butt on
Tuesday in Anderson Funeral Home, 895 Oullette Avenue, and burial will
follow in Greenlawn Memorial Park.

Note: daughter of Caleb Woodworth Chandler and Sarah Bowerman Chandler
